The decision to rent or buy a cable modem is a classic trade-off between and short-term convenience . Most major internet service providers (ISPs) charge between $10 and $20 per month for equipment. While this provides a hassle-free experience with free technical support and replacements, purchasing your own hardware usually pays for itself in less than a year. The average monthly rental fee in 2026 is approximately $15, totaling $180 annually. By contrast, a high-quality standalone modem costs between $90 and $130.
